Health Professions and Related Programs at Shawnee State University
Ranked 403rd of 490 associate programs in Health Professions and Related Programs by 5-year earnings.
Median · 1 year out
$50,767
middle 50%: $39,707 – $60,753
Median · 5 years out
$58,878
middle 50%: $45,989 – $71,620
Median · 10 years out
$65,088
middle 50%: $50,976 – $82,604
Salary trajectory
Median earnings vs the national median for Health Professions and Related Programs (associate) graduates.
This program (median)National median, same major & degreeMiddle 50% of graduates
Shawnee State University health program graduates earn a median of $51k initially. By year ten, the median salary is $65k.
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
